Control the battlefield with tight, responsive inputs.
Winning isn’t just about spraying bullets. Pick your load‑out early; each weapon has its own recoil pattern and range. Use grenades to flush enemies out of cover, then slide in with a quick crouch‑run combo. Keep an eye on the mini‑map – enemy spawns follow predictable waves, but the timing shifts after each level. Master the art of “peek‑shoot‑retreat” to stay alive. Upgrade your gear whenever you clear a stage; better optics, faster reloads, and stronger armor keep you ahead of the AI. Remember, the higher you climb, the tighter the corridors and the smarter the opponents. Adapt, stay mobile, and never linger in one spot.
